Transaction 53aedc96b4cacf3b958178defed187854093a3b2a3b9249f6a5910a05ae26e2d
1 Input
1 Output
-
53aedc96b4cacf3b958178defed187854093a3b2a3b9249f6a5910a05ae26e2d:0
- value
- 919818
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8a996a7dc22819d64ed435b41b14e8a19333af42 OP_EQUAL
- address
- 3EKrxYbhgihubWyP4ApjhZi2KCCfeGgbKF